How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    We are actively looking to engage automotive product experts for an exciting role as an E-Commerce Sales Manager in Alfreton, Derbyshire! The role will be based in Alfreton in Derbyshire on a hybrid basis of 2 days per week.

    Client Details

    Our client is a market-leading producer of high-end manufactured automotive products distributed across the UK and worldwide. You will be joining a fast-paced environment in a production and distribution logistics hub with circa 250 colleagues across operations, supply chain and production. The business is a growing SME business dedicated to bespoke UK manufacturing based in Alfreton, Derbyshire. The business is currently on-going a large transition into activating their product range within the E-Commerce space - utilising channels such as Amazon, Ebay etc.

    Job Description

    As a E-Commerce Sales Manager you will report in to the Sales Director on a daily basis. You will be responsible for the following areas across the Alfreton, Derbyshire office:

    * Set up, launch, and manage online sales channels across marketplaces such as eBay and Amazon, ensuring accurate product listings and consistent brand presentation.

    * Independently develop and execute e-commerce sales strategies to drive revenue growth across a high-SKU automotive parts catalogue.

    * Create, optimise, and maintain product listings, including pricing, descriptions, images, and keyword strategies to maximise visibility and conversion rates.

    * Monitor marketplace performance metrics (sales, margins, traffic, conversion rates) and implement data-driven improvements.

    * Collaborate closely with the Sales Director to align online sales strategies with overall commercial objectives and targets.

    * Work alongside the Customer Service Manager to ensure a seamless customer journey, including handling queries, returns, and feedback effectively.

    * Manage inventory coordination and stock availability across platforms, ensuring accurate syncing with internal systems for a large and complex SKU base.

    * Stay up to date with marketplace policies, trends, and competitor activity, proactively identifying opportunities to expand channels and improve performance.

    The Ideal Candidate

    The successful candidate will have an expansive background in the manufacturing industry, ideally within the automotive parts sector. The ideal E-Commerce Sales Manager will have the following skills and experience:

    * 3+ year's experience in a similar e-commerce sales based role (ideally within automotive or high volume manufactured products).

    * Proven experience managing e-commerce marketplaces (e.g. eBay, Amazon), including setting up and optimising product listings.

    *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ret sales data, KPIs, and performance metrics to drive growth.

    * Experience working with large product catalogues (high SKU environments), ideally within automotive parts or a similar technical industry.

    * Ability to work independently, take initiative, and man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.

    * Excellent communication and collaboration skills to work effectively with sales leadership and customer service teams.

    * Commutable to Alfreton, Derbyshire, on a hybrid basis.

    What's On Offer?

    * £45,000-£55,000

    * 32 days annual leave

    * Company managerial bonus (uncapped in line with company profits)

    * Comprehensive company benefits account.

    * High-end training & development and large opportunities to progress
